How did the populist movement affect america?

Answers

Answer 1

Answer:

It called for graduated income tax, direct election of Senators, a shorter workweek, restrictions on immigration to the United States, and public ownership of railroads and communication lines. The Populists appealed most strongly to voters in the South, the Great Plains, and the Rocky Mountains.

Sullivan Ballou, a Union soldier during the American Civil War, wrote a heartfelt letter to his wife Sarah before the Battle of Bull Run in 1861. In the letter, Ballou reflects on the significance of the war and compares it to the American Revolution.

Ballou acknowledges the historical importance of both conflicts, recognizing that the American Revolution was fought to secure independence and freedom for the nation. He sees the Civil War as another pivotal moment in American history, where the ideals of liberty and unity are at stake. Ballou emphasizes that the current conflict is a test of whether the American experiment will endure or perish.

Therefore, Sullivan Ballou compares the Civil War to the American Revolution by recognizing their shared significance in shaping the nation's destiny.

How did they trade alliance with France help the United States win the war of independence against the britian

Answers

Answer:

At the start of the war, France helped by providing supplies to the Continental Army such as gunpowder, cannons, clothing, and shoes. In 1778, France became an official ally of the United States through the Treaty of Alliance. At this point the French became directly involved in the war.

The golden ratio is a mathematical proportion that appears in nature and certain works of art.

It is calculated by dividing a line into two parts so that the ratio of the longer part to the shorter part is equal to the ratio of the sum of both parts to the longer part. In other words, the ratio of each part to the whole is the same ratio.

This ratio is roughly 1:1.618 and is often referred to as Phi, the Greek letter that signifies the golden ratio. The golden ratio has been found to be pervasive in nature, from the spirals of seashells to the proportions of the human body. It has also been used throughout history by artists and designers to create aesthetically pleasing works of art.
